Merhaba arkadaşlar, bu yazımızda girilen iki ifadeyi birleştirerek tek bir ifade haline getirmek için gereken kodu paylaşacağım. Aslında bunu gerçekleştirmek çok kolay. C++’ın bize sağladığı kütüphanesi sayesinde, strcat() fonksiyonunu kullanarak ikinci ifadeyi birincinin arkasına ekliyoruz.

#include<iostream>
#include<cstring>
 
using namespace std;

int main()
{
	char ch1[50] = "caner";
	char ch2[50] = "canbaz";
	cout << "1. Ifade: " << ch1;
	cout << "\n2. Ifade: " << ch2;
	strcat(ch1,ch2);
	cout << "\nBirlestirilmis ifade : " << ch1;
	return 0;
}

Çıktı

1. Ifade : caner
2. Ifade : canbaz
Birlestirilmis ifade : canercanbaz